You should play Star Wars: The Force Unleashed because it lets you experience the Star Wars universe from the perspective of Darth Vader’s secret apprentice, Starkiller. The game gives you powerful Force abilities like lightning, telekinesis, and lightsaber combat, letting you wreak havoc in creative ways. The story is dramatic and explores an alternate take on the origins of the Rebel Alliance. It's action-packed, cinematic, and offers a satisfying power fantasy for Star Wars fans.

You should play Ryse: Son of Rome because it delivers a visually stunning, story-driven experience set in ancient Rome. You play as a Roman soldier named Marius seeking revenge while rising through the ranks of the Roman army. The game features brutal, cinematic melee combat with smooth execution sequences. Although the gameplay is linear, it’s tightly focused, with a strong narrative and intense battles that make it a memorable short campaign.
